The Link between RSS reader and Feed on a Site

Is it really needed to copy the url of the feed?

I just finished adding a RSS feed on my site. I download a rss reader and thought that with a click on the rss feed link on my site, the rss reader would pick it up right away.

To my surprise it does not work this way. It seems that you have to copy the link of the domain or even the specific feed url and paste it in the new feed field of the rss reader.

Am I missing something? I can't imagine that people will embrase this "complicated" way in this day and age to build a collection of feeds.
I would like to see a reader that pick up the feed whe I click on it, or the option to right click and command "add this rss feed".

Does this exist? If so why isn't every reader equiped with this feature?
